Night fox

The Night fox is a recurring monster in the Dragon Quest series, first appearing in Dragon Quest VIII: Journey of the Cursed King. It is a cunning canidae dressed as French musketeer.

CharacteristicsEdit

Night foxes are anthropomorphic fox fencers with bright blue fur who are nocturnal by nature. They wear doublets with yellow stripes with ruffs and long capes around their necks, rounded hose, tall boots, and cavalier hats with a long plume on their heads, giving them a foppish appearance. The foxes have some simple spellcasting ability, being able to cast Heal, and can use their fancy footwork to confuse their enemies. They are also capable of delivering thrusts with their rapiers at lightning speed.
